Manchester Derby and Champions League Action Heats Up the Football Calendar

The Premier League and Champions League are about to burst into action, with some of the biggest matches of the season on the horizon. In the Premier League, Manchester City and Manchester United will face off in the Manchester Derby, which promises to be a fiercely contested battle between two teams with different fortunes. Manchester United, led by manager Ruben Amorim, will look to upset the odds and claim an underdog victory over their rivals, despite being ahead in the table.

On the opposing side, Pep Guardiola's Manchester City is dealing with a sudden injury crisis, which may force the manager to alter his team's setup. Guardiola will have to make some tough decisions on the back of Manchester City's rare loss to Brighton, while Manchester United will be without key players Lisandro Martinez, Mason Mount, and Matheus Cunha. The match is expected to be a cagey back-and-forth between the two clubs, with both managers prioritizing possession-based styles to break down each other's defenses.

Meanwhile, the Champions League returns after a three-month hiatus, with match week one featuring some exciting games. In one of the standout matches, Borussia Dortmund and Juventus will face off in Turin, with international talents and skilled players on both sides looking to make their mark. Another enticing matchup is between Chelsea FC and Bayern Munich, with Chelsea's young squad of talent taking on the experienced Bayern squad led by manager Vincent Kompany.
